“We like to open our stores before Thanksgiving, before the big retail season starts,” Hively said.
The planned store is Walgreen’s first in Marshfield. The developer/landlord for the Marshfield site is Tulsa, Okla.-based Pinnacle Commercial Group LLC.
Hively said the building’s size is typical of the chain’s locations, and it will include a pharmacy drive-through.
Publicly traded Walgreens (NYSE: WAG) has 170 stores in Missouri, and a total of 6,237 stores in every state and in Puerto Rico. The company’s stock traded this morning at $35.43 per share compared to a 52-week range of $32.50 to $49.10.
